Clint Eastwood: A Hollywood Icon
Before we tackle the elephant in the room, let's take a trip down memory lane and explore the incredible career of Clint Eastwood. Born on May 31, 1930, in San Francisco, California, Clint Eastwood has been a staple in Hollywood for over six decades. With a career spanning over 150 films, it's no wonder that this icon has left an indelible mark on the movie industry.
The Early Years
Kicking off his acting career in the late 1950s, Clint Eastwood initially found fame on the small screen, starring in the popular Western TV series, "Rawhide." But it was his big-screen debut in Sergio Leone's "A Fistful of Dollars" (1964) that truly launched his career as a global superstar.
The Man with No Name Trilogy
In the 1960s, Clint Eastwood cemented his status as a Hollywood heavyweight with his iconic "Man with No Name" trilogy. Starring in "A Fistful of Dollars" (1964), "For a Few Dollars More" (1965), and "The Good, the Bad and the Ugly" (1966), Eastwood's unique blend of tough-guy swagger and dry humor captivated audiences worldwide.
The Dirty Harry Series
As the 1970s rolled in, Clint Eastwood returned to the big screen with a bang, starring in the gritty crime thriller, "Dirty Harry" (1971). The film was a massive success, spawning four sequels and solidifying Eastwood's status as an action hero for the ages.
Directing and Producing
In addition to his impressive acting career, Clint Eastwood has also made a significant impact behind the camera. Since making his directorial debut with "Play Misty for Me" in 1971, Eastwood has gone on to direct and produce some of the most acclaimed films in Hollywood history, including "Unforgiven" (1992), "Mystic River" (2003), and "American Sniper" (2014).
